I. Understanding the Conversion: From Centimeters to Inches

The metric system, based on powers of 10, uses centimeters (cm) as a unit of length. The imperial system, prevalent in countries like the US and the UK, uses inches (in) for shorter distances. One inch is defined as exactly 2.54 centimeters. Therefore, to convert centimeters to inches, we divide the number of centimeters by 2.54.

For 120 centimeters:

120 cm / 2.54 cm/in ≈ 47.24 inches

Therefore, 120 centimeters is approximately equal to 47.24 inches. While we'll use the approximate value for practical purposes in this article, remember that the exact conversion is 47.244094488 inches.

VI.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s):

1. Q: What is the exact conversion of 120 cm to inches?
A: The exact conversion is 47.244094488 inches.


2. Q: Is it always necessary to use the exact conversion?
A: No. For most everyday situations, an approximation is sufficient. High precision is only necessary for specialized tasks demanding accuracy.


3. Q: How can I convert inches to centimeters?
A: Multiply the number of inches by 2.54.
